WebAccording to Survey of India, 2004 Tsunami hit Cuddalore, Chennai Paradip, Machilipatanam, Nagapattinam and Vishakhapatnam between 8 am and 9 am (IST) (Navalgund, 2005). Tamil Nadu, Andhra Pradesh and Andaman and Nicobar Islands were worst affected. Nagapattinam district in Tamil Nadu saw massive destruction.
